Freedom for dissidents

PRESS TRUST OF INDIA

BEIJING, Nov 17: A Chinese activist said today that he had written to President Jiang Zemin pleading for the release of other pro-democracy campaigners, including Wang Dan.

``I wanted to pressurise the President, to express to him the wishes of China's pro-democracy activists,'' Qin Yongmin said a day after China freed dissident Wei Jingsheng on medical parole. A Hong Kong-based human rights group also said today that another dissident, Lin Xinshu, was detained briefly yesterday.
